For LSP methods/pickers:
- references
- definition
- typeDefinition
- implementation

Passes the server results through client (and neovim's) lsp handler
function.
This lets those handlers deal with some of the language server specific
idiosyncrasies.

Also refactors shared code between these pickers.

Other pickers/methods will need similar treatment.

local channel = require("plenary.async.control").channel
local actions = require "telescope.actions"
local sorters = require "telescope.sorters"
local conf = require("telescope.config").values
local finders = require "telescope.finders"
local make_entry = require "telescope.make_entry"
local pickers = require "telescope.pickers"
local utils = require "telescope.utils"
local lsp = {}
local function call_hierarchy(opts, method, title, direction, item)
vim.lsp.buf_request(opts.bufnr, method, { item = item }, function(err, result)
if err then
vim.api.nvim_err_writeln("Error handling " .. title .. ": " .. err.message)
return
end
if not result or vim.tbl_isempty(result) then
return
end
local locations = {}
for _, ch_call in pairs(result) do
local ch_item = ch_call[direction]
table.insert(locations, {
filename = vim.uri_to_fname(ch_item.uri),
text = ch_item.name,
lnum = ch_item.range.start.line + 1,
col = ch_item.range.start.character + 1,
})
end
pickers
.new(opts, {
prompt_title = title,
finder = finders.new_table {
results = locations,
entry_maker = opts.entry_maker or make_entry.gen_from_quickfix(opts),
},
previewer = conf.qflist_previewer(opts),
sorter = conf.generic_sorter(opts),
push_cursor_on_edit = true,
push_tagstack_on_edit = true,
})
:find()
end)
end
local function pick_call_hierarchy_item(call_hierarchy_items)
if not call_hierarchy_items then
return
end
if #call_hierarchy_items == 1 then
return call_hierarchy_items[1]
end
local items = {}
for i, item in pairs(call_hierarchy_items) do
local entry = item.detail or item.name
table.insert(items, string.format("%d. %s", i, entry))
end
local choice = vim.fn.inputlist(items)
if choice < 1 or choice > #items then
return
end
return choice
end
local function calls(opts, direction)
local params = vim.lsp.util.make_position_params()
vim.lsp.buf_request(opts.bufnr, "textDocument/prepareCallHierarchy", params, function(err, result)
if err then
vim.api.nvim_err_writeln("Error when preparing call hierarchy: " .. err)
return
end
local call_hierarchy_item = pick_call_hierarchy_item(result)
if not call_hierarchy_item then
return
end
if direction == "from" then
call_hierarchy(opts, "callHierarchy/incomingCalls", "LSP Incoming Calls", direction, call_hierarchy_item)
else
call_hierarchy(opts, "callHierarchy/outgoingCalls", "LSP Outgoing Calls", direction, call_hierarchy_item)
end
end)
end
lsp.incoming_calls = function(opts)
calls(opts, "from")
end
lsp.outgoing_calls = function(opts)
calls(opts, "to")
end
---@param err lsp.ResponseError
---@param result lsp.ProgressParams
---@param ctx lsp.HandlerContext
---@param action string
---@return table
local function pass_thru_client_handler(err, result, ctx, action)
local items
local function on_list(options)
items = options.items
end
if not vim.tbl_islist(result) then
result = { result }
end
local client = vim.lsp.get_client_by_id(ctx.client_id)
local handler = client.handlers[action] or vim.lsp.handlers[action]
handler(err, result, ctx, { on_list = on_list })
return items
end
local function list_or_jump(action, title, params, opts)
vim.lsp.buf_request(opts.bufnr, action, params, function(err, result, ctx, _)
if err then
vim.api.nvim_err_writeln("Error when executing " .. action .. " : " .. err.message)
return
end
if result == nil or vim.tbl_isempty(result) then
return
end
local items = pass_thru_client_handler(err, result, ctx, action)
if opts.include_current_line == false then
items = vim.tbl_filter(function(item)
return not (
item.filename == vim.api.nvim_buf_get_name(opts.bufnr)
and item.lnum == vim.api.nvim_win_get_cursor(opts.winnr)[1]
)
end, items)
end
if vim.tbl_isempty(items) then
return
elseif #items == 1 and opts.jump_type ~= "never" then
local location = items[1].user_data
local uri = params.textDocument.uri
local location_uri = location.uri or location.targetUri
if uri ~= location_uri then
if opts.jump_type == "tab" then
vim.cmd "tabedit"
elseif opts.jump_type == "split" then
vim.cmd "new"
elseif opts.jump_type == "vsplit" then
vim.cmd "vnew"
elseif opts.jump_type == "tab drop" then
local file_path = vim.uri_to_fname(location_uri)
vim.cmd("tab drop " .. file_path)
end
end
local client = vim.lsp.get_client_by_id(ctx.client_id)
vim.lsp.util.jump_to_location(location, client.offset_encoding, opts.reuse_win)
else
pickers
.new(opts, {
prompt_title = title,
finder = finders.new_table {
results = items,
entry_maker = opts.entry_maker or make_entry.gen_from_quickfix(opts),
},
previewer = conf.qflist_previewer(opts),
sorter = conf.generic_sorter(opts),
push_cursor_on_edit = true,
push_tagstack_on_edit = true,
})
:find()
end
end)
end
lsp.references = function(opts)
local params = vim.lsp.util.make_position_params(opts.winnr)
params.context = { includeDeclaration = vim.F.if_nil(opts.include_declaration, true) }
return list_or_jump("textDocument/references", "LSP References", params, opts)
end
lsp.definitions = function(opts)
local params = vim.lsp.util.make_position_params(opts.winnr)
return list_or_jump("textDocument/definition", "LSP Definitions", params, opts)
end
lsp.type_definitions = function(opts)
local params = vim.lsp.util.make_position_params(opts.winnr)
return list_or_jump("textDocument/typeDefinition", "LSP Type Definitions", params, opts)
end
lsp.implementations = function(opts)
local params = vim.lsp.util.make_position_params(opts.winnr)
return list_or_jump("textDocument/implementation", "LSP Implementations", params, opts)
end
local symbols_sorter = function(symbols)
if vim.tbl_isempty(symbols) then
return symbols
end
local current_buf = vim.api.nvim_get_current_buf()
-- sort adequately for workspace symbols
local filename_to_bufnr = {}
for _, symbol in ipairs(symbols) do
if filename_to_bufnr[symbol.filename] == nil then
filename_to_bufnr[symbol.filename] = vim.uri_to_bufnr(vim.uri_from_fname(symbol.filename))
end
symbol.bufnr = filename_to_bufnr[symbol.filename]
end
table.sort(symbols, function(a, b)
if a.bufnr == b.bufnr then
return a.lnum < b.lnum
end
if a.bufnr == current_buf then
return true
end
if b.bufnr == current_buf then
return false
end
return a.bufnr < b.bufnr
end)
return symbols
end
lsp.document_symbols = function(opts)
local params = vim.lsp.util.make_position_params(opts.winnr)
vim.lsp.buf_request(opts.bufnr, "textDocument/documentSymbol", params, function(err, result, _, _)
if err then
vim.api.nvim_err_writeln("Error when finding document symbols: " .. err.message)
return
end
if not result or vim.tbl_isempty(result) then
utils.notify("builtin.lsp_document_symbols", {
msg = "No results from textDocument/documentSymbol",
level = "INFO",
})
return
end
local locations = vim.lsp.util.symbols_to_items(result or {}, opts.bufnr) or {}
locations = utils.filter_symbols(locations, opts, symbols_sorter)
if locations == nil then
-- error message already printed in `utils.filter_symbols`
return
end
if vim.tbl_isempty(locations) then
utils.notify("builtin.lsp_document_symbols", {
msg = "No document_symbol locations found",
level = "INFO",
})
return
end
opts.path_display = { "hidden" }
pickers
.new(opts, {
prompt_title = "LSP Document Symbols",
finder = finders.new_table {
results = locations,
entry_maker = opts.entry_maker or make_entry.gen_from_lsp_symbols(opts),
},
previewer = conf.qflist_previewer(opts),
sorter = conf.prefilter_sorter {
tag = "symbol_type",
sorter = conf.generic_sorter(opts),
},
push_cursor_on_edit = true,
push_tagstack_on_edit = true,
})
:find()
end)
end
lsp.workspace_symbols = function(opts)
local params = { query = opts.query or "" }
vim.lsp.buf_request(opts.bufnr, "workspace/symbol", params, function(err, server_result, _, _)
if err then
vim.api.nvim_err_writeln("Error when finding workspace symbols: " .. err.message)
return
end
local locations = vim.lsp.util.symbols_to_items(server_result or {}, opts.bufnr) or {}
locations = utils.filter_symbols(locations, opts, symbols_sorter)
if locations == nil then
-- error message already printed in `utils.filter_symbols`
return
end
if vim.tbl_isempty(locations) then
utils.notify("builtin.lsp_workspace_symbols", {
msg = "No results from workspace/symbol. Maybe try a different query: "
.. "'Telescope lsp_workspace_symbols query=example'",
level = "INFO",
})
return
end
opts.ignore_filename = vim.F.if_nil(opts.ignore_filename, false)
pickers
.new(opts, {
prompt_title = "LSP Workspace Symbols",
finder = finders.new_table {
results = locations,
entry_maker = opts.entry_maker or make_entry.gen_from_lsp_symbols(opts),
},
previewer = conf.qflist_previewer(opts),
sorter = conf.prefilter_sorter {
tag = "symbol_type",
sorter = conf.generic_sorter(opts),
},
})
:find()
end)
end
local function get_workspace_symbols_requester(bufnr, opts)
local cancel = function() end
return function(prompt)
local tx, rx = channel.oneshot()
cancel()
_, cancel = vim.lsp.buf_request(bufnr, "workspace/symbol", { query = prompt }, tx)
-- Handle 0.5 / 0.5.1 handler situation
local err, res = rx()
assert(not err, err)
local locations = vim.lsp.util.symbols_to_items(res or {}, bufnr) or {}
if not vim.tbl_isempty(locations) then
locations = utils.filter_symbols(locations, opts, symbols_sorter) or {}
end
return locations
end
end
lsp.dynamic_workspace_symbols = function(opts)
pickers
.new(opts, {
prompt_title = "LSP Dynamic Workspace Symbols",
finder = finders.new_dynamic {
entry_maker = opts.entry_maker or make_entry.gen_from_lsp_symbols(opts),
fn = get_workspace_symbols_requester(opts.bufnr, opts),
},
previewer = conf.qflist_previewer(opts),
sorter = sorters.highlighter_only(opts),
attach_mappings = function(_, map)
map("i", "<c-space>", actions.to_fuzzy_refine)
return true
end,
})
:find()
end
local function check_capabilities(method, bufnr)
local clients = vim.lsp.get_active_clients { bufnr = bufnr }
for _, client in pairs(clients) do
if client.supports_method(method, { bufnr = bufnr }) then
return true
end
end
if #clients == 0 then
utils.notify("builtin.lsp_*", {
msg = "no client attached",
level = "INFO",
})
else
utils.notify("builtin.lsp_*", {
msg = "server does not support " .. method,
level = "INFO",
})
end
return false
end
local feature_map = {
["document_symbols"] = "textDocument/documentSymbol",
["references"] = "textDocument/references",
["definitions"] = "textDocument/definition",
["type_definitions"] = "textDocument/typeDefinition",
["implementations"] = "textDocument/implementation",
["workspace_symbols"] = "workspace/symbol",
["incoming_calls"] = "callHierarchy/incomingCalls",
["outgoing_calls"] = "callHierarchy/outgoingCalls",
}
local function apply_checks(mod)
for k, v in pairs(mod) do
mod[k] = function(opts)
opts = opts or {}
local method = feature_map[k]
if method and not check_capabilities(method, opts.bufnr) then
return
end
v(opts)
end
end
return mod
end
return apply_checks(lsp)
